When it comes to safety, tempered glass stands out as an exceptional choice due to its durability and resistance to impact. Unlike regular glass, which can shatter easily, tempered glass undergoes a rigorous heating and cooling process that increases its strength. This treatment allows it to withstand greater stress and external forces, making it an ideal option for environments where safety is a priority. In fact, tempered glass is often used in windows, doors, and even shower enclosures, where high durability is essential.
In addition to its strength, tempered glass also boasts impressive thermal stability. It can withstand extreme temperature changes without breaking, which adds an extra layer of safety in both residential and commercial applications. For example, in areas with significant temperature fluctuations, tempered glass can be relied upon to maintain structural integrity. Furthermore, if tempered glass does break, it shatters into small, blunt pieces rather than sharp shards, reducing the risk of injury. This unique feature further solidifies its reputation as a superior choice for safety.

In today's modern interiors, tempered glass has emerged as a popular choice, seamlessly merging style with strength. Known for its impressive durability, tempered glass undergoes a special heating process that makes it significantly more resistant to impact and thermal stress compared to regular glass. This not only enhances safety—reducing the risk of shattering—but also allows for larger, uninterrupted views in architectural designs. Many homeowners appreciate this combination of functionality and aesthetics, as tempered glass offers a sleek, contemporary look that elevates any space.

Caring for your tempered glass surfaces is essential to ensure their longevity and maintain their stunning appearance. Start by regularly cleaning the glass with a soft cloth or microfiber towel to avoid scratching the surface. For tougher stains, use a mild detergent mixed with warm water, and avoid abrasive cleaners or scrubbers. It's also important to use glass-specific cleaning solutions to enhance clarity and shine. Remember to wipe in a circular motion to prevent streaks and maintain that crystal-clear finish.
In addition to regular cleaning, consider the placement of your tempered glass surfaces to protect them from everyday wear and tear. Avoid placing heavy items directly on the glass, as this could lead to potential chips or cracks. When hosting events, use coasters or placemats to prevent heat damage and scratches from utensils. Lastly, always check for any signs of damage or wear, as addressing issues early can prolong the lifespan of your glass surfaces and keep them looking pristine.
